What is Hydrolyzed Forsythia Viridissima Fruit/Root Extract?
Hydrolyzed Forsythia Viridissima Fruit/Root Extract is a unique cosmetic ingredient derived from the fruit of Forsythia viridissima and the roots of several other plants, including Angelica acutiloba, Cimicifuga dahurica, Glycyrrhiza glabra (commonly known as licorice), Paeonia lactiflora, Platycodon grandiflorus, and Pueraria lobata. This ingredient is also known by its more technical name, Hydrolyzed Forsythia Viridissima Fruit/(Angelica Acutiloba/Cimicifuga Dahurica/Glycyrrhiza Glabra (Licorice)/Paeonia Lactiflora/Platycodon Grandiflorus/Pueraria Lobata) Root Extract. The hydrolysis process, which can involve acid, enzymes, or other methods, breaks down the extract into smaller, more manageable components, making it easier for the skin to absorb.
The history of Hydrolyzed Forsythia Viridissima Fruit/Root Extract in cosmetics is rooted in traditional herbal medicine, where these plants have been used for their various beneficial properties. Forsythia viridissima, for instance, has been valued for its an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ties. Over time, the cosmetic industry has harnessed these benefits, incorporating the extract into skincare products to enhance their efficacy.
The process of making this extract involves hydrolysis, a method that breaks down the plant materials into smaller molecules. This can be achieved through the use of acids, enzymes, or other hydrolyzing agents. The result is a hydrolysate that retains the beneficial properties of the original plants but in a form that is more readily absorbed by the skin. This makes Hydrolyzed Forsythia Viridissima Fruit/Root Extract a valuable ingredient in skin conditioning products, helping to improve the overall health and appearance of the skin.

Potential Side Effects & Other Considerations
Hydrolyzed Forsythia Viridissima Fruit/Root Extract is generally considered safe for topical application in cosmetic products. However, as with any ingredient, there are potential side effects and considerations to keep in mind:
- Skin irritation
- Allergic reactions
- Redness
- Itching
Regarding individuals who are pregnant or breastfeeding, data and research on the topical usage of Hydrolyzed Forsythia Viridissima Fruit/Root Extract during pregnancy and breastfeeding are lacking. Therefore, it is advisable for these individuals to consult a healthcare professional for further advice before using products containing this ingredient.
Side effects and adverse reactions from this ingredient are generally uncommon. However, it is always recommended to perform a patch test before widespread usage to ensure there are no adverse reactions.
On a comedogenicity scale of 0 to 5, Hydrolyzed Forsythia Viridissima Fruit/Root Extract is rated as 0, meaning it is non-comedogenic. This makes it suitable for individuals prone to acne, blemishes, or breakouts, as it is unlikely to clog pores.
